South Africa’s National Prosecuting Authority (NPA) has opened applications for its 2026 Internship Programme targeting Accounting and Business Management graduates. This opportunity, based at the DPP Grahamstown (Makhanda) office, offers a monthly stipend of R7,142 and invaluable professional experience in public service.

Internship Details
| Position Title | Intern – Accounting / Business Management |
|---|---|
| Reference Number | GRHM (X2 Posts) |
| Location | DPP Grahamstown (Makhanda) |
| Duration | 24 months (TVET placement) |
| Stipend | R7,142 per month |
| Closing Date | 3 November 2025 |
| Contact Person | Masixole Kate |
| Email for Applications | grhm@npa.gov.za |
This internship targets TVET and university graduates who require work experience to complete or complement their qualifications.
Who Can Apply
Eligible candidates must meet the following criteria:
- South African citizens aged 18–35.
- Unemployed graduates with no prior participation in any government internship or learnership.
- Residents of the Eastern Cape, preferably near Makhanda.
- Clean criminal record with no pending cases.
- Qualification in one of the following fields:
- Accounting
- Business Management
- Business Administration
- Logistics
- Or related disciplines
The NPA strongly encourages people with disabilities to apply.

How to Apply
Step 1: Complete the Z83 Form
Download the latest form from the DPSA website at https://www.dpsa.gov.za. Fill it in completely and indicate the reference number GRHM (X2 Posts).
Step 2: Prepare Supporting Documents
Attach the following:
- Comprehensive CV
- Certified ID copy
- Certified academic records and certificates
- Proof of residence (if available)
Step 3: Submit Your Application
Email all documents to grhm@npa.gov.za before 3 November 2025, with the subject line:
REF NO: GRHM (X2 POSTS) – INTERN ACCOUNTING / BUSINESS MANAGEMENT
Late or incomplete applications will not be considered.
